Served as the titular Maharaja of Mysore after the princely states were integrated into India. Played a role in the cultural and social development of Karnataka. Actively engaged in various philanthropic efforts throughout the region. Held a position of dignity and traditional leadership in Mysore, significantly influencing local governance and community initiatives.

First leader of the Mysore royal family post-independence

Contributed to local cultural initiatives

Promoted educational institutions in Karnataka

Thomas Johann Seebeck

Physicist known for thermoelectricity
Born
April 9th, 1770 255 years ago
Died
December 10th, 1831 194 years ago — 61 years old

This physicist contributed significantly to the field of thermoelectricity. In 1821, conducted experiments that led to the discovery of the thermoelectric effect. This phenomenon describes how a voltage is generated in a wire when subjected to a temperature difference. Served as a professor at the University of Berlin and contributed to the understanding of magnetic fields and their effects on electrical circuits. Published various scientific papers that laid foundational principles in physics.

Leopold I of Belgium

Belgian King and constitutional monarch
Born
December 16th, 1790 235 years ago
Died
December 10th, 1865 160 years ago — 74 years old

Reigned as the first King of the Belgians from 1831 until death in 1865. Ascended the throne following Belgium's independence from the Netherlands. Established a constitutional monarchy, providing stability to the nation during its formative years. Engaged in diplomatic efforts to gain international recognition for Belgium's sovereignty and worked to modernize the country. Oversaw the establishment of various institutions and infrastructures, promoting trade and industry.

Franjo Tuđman

Croatian historian and politician, 1st President
Born
May 14th, 1922 103 years ago
Died
December 10th, 1999 26 years ago — 77 years old

A prominent figure in Croatian history and politics, this individual served as the first President of Croatia from 1990 to 1999. A historian by training, significant contributions included advocating for Croatian independence from Yugoslavia. Played a crucial role during the Croatian War of Independence, shaping the new nation's political landscape and institutions. His presidency was marked by efforts to establish Croatia as a sovereign state and navigate post-war recovery.
